COMMISSIONING ASSISTANT MANAGER
POSITION SCOPE AND ORGANIZATIONAL IMPACT
Moss Energy is seeking a dedicated Commissioning Assistant Manager to lead and oversee the startup and delivery of utility-scale solar and battery energy storage (BESS) projects. This leadership role is responsible for supervising commissioning teams managing onsite technical activities and ensuring that all electrical systems meet safety reliability and performance standards prior to energization. The Commissioning Assistant Manager serves as a critical bridge between field execution and senior management to drive project completion.
ESSENTIAL JOB D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Lead and supervise the testing and commissioning of medium- and low-voltage electrical systems including inverters transformers and BESS power distribution equipment.
Oversee the execution of NETA-based testingsuch as Megger (insulation resistance) VOC Testing VLF and TTRwhile ensuring accuracy and compliance in all performance validation.
Manage the startup energization and complex troubleshooting of AC and DC components providing technical guidance to field technicians on solar and BESS sites.
Review and interpret complex electrical drawings schematics and one-line diagrams to verify installation quality and resolve critical field engineering issues.
Coordinate directly with construction leads SCADA teams and utility partners to ensure seamless system integration and communication protocols.
Review and finalize commissioning documentation test results and turnover packages to ensure they meet project milestones and industry standards.
Enforce strict adherence to safety protocols electrical codes (NEC/NFPA 70E) and site-specific safety requirements across the commissioning team.
Manage and audit energy isolation procedures (LOTO) to ensure a zero-incident environment during the transition from construction to operations.
Assist the Commissioning Director in resource planning scheduling and progress reporting for multiple project sites.
